Excerpt from R. H. D: Appreciations of Richard Harding Davis HE was almost too good to be true. In addition, the gods loved him, and so he had to die young. Some people think that a man OW middle-aged. But if R. H. D. Had lived to be a hundred, he would never have grown old. It is not generally known that the name of his other brother was Peter Pan.
